What Is Criminal Assault Louisiana — La R.S. 14:36
Assault is an attempt to commit a battery, or the intentional placing of another in reasonable apprehension of receiving a battery.
Simple Assault — La. R.S. 14:38
Simple assault is an assault committed without a dangerous weapon, i.e. a hand.
Whoever commits a simple assault shall be fined not more than two hundred dollars, or imprisoned for not more than ninety days, or both.
